Grog

Grog

Gulping down a flagon 

Gives one a gibbous glow. 

Gather 'round ye hardies,

Grab one and have a go. 

Ghostly foam and farting 

Gnomes bilge one gushing flow.

Garish gaffe...drinking Grog!


deborah burch©12/4/2016

_______________________________

Form: Pleiades
